In '30 Years Among the Dead' by Dead Carl Wickland, the reader is taken on a fascinating journey into the world of spirits and the afterlife. The book is written in a straightforward and informative style, detailing Dr. Wickland's experiences as a psychiatrist treating patients possessed by spirits. Through a series of case studies, he explores the complexities of spirit possession and the impact it has on both the living and the dead. This book provides a unique perspective on the intersection of psychology and the supernatural, making it a compelling read for anyone interested in parapsychology and metaphysical phenomena. The literary context of this work is significant as it challenges conventional beliefs and opens up new possibilities for understanding the mysteries of the human mind and spirit. Dead Carl Wickland, a well-known psychiatrist and spiritualist, was deeply fascinated by the spiritual world and dedicated his life to studying the phenomenon of spirit possession. His personal experiences and professional expertise led him to write '30 Years Among the Dead', a groundbreaking work that sheds light on a subject often ignored or dismissed by mainstream science and psychology.
